JAKARTA - The Corruption Eradication Commission (KPK) has entrusted the suspected briber of the non-active Langkat Regent Syah Afandin, Yaqub Abdhal Al Mu'arif at the North Sumatra Police. It is not yet known when he will be transferred to the KPK Detention Center.

"Currently, suspect YQB is still being detained at the North Sumatra Regional Police," said KPK spokesperson Budi Prasetyo to reporters through his written statement, Monday, July 6.

Yaqub is known not to have been brought to Jakarta like Syah Afandin due to technical problems after the hand-in-hand operation (OTT) last week. The team then ran out of tickets to Jakarta, so he was temporarily placed at the Medan Police Detention Center.

Although Yaqub is still being held at the North Sumatra Regional Police Detention Center, Budi said that the handling of the alleged bribery of the project that ensnared Syah Afandin is still ongoing. Investigators are said to be immediately searching a number of locations that have already been sealed.

"After the determination of the suspect, the investigators will certainly complete the additional evidence needed, either through searches at locations in North Sumatra, which have been sealed at the investigation stage yesterday or the examination of witnesses later," he said.

As previously reported, the KPK named Syah Afandin as a suspect in receiving bribes and Yaqub Abdhal Al Mu'arif as a suspect in giving bribes related to projects at the Education Office and the Langkat Regency Housing and Residential Area (Perkim).

In addition to the alleged project bribes, the KPK also found indications of other gratification received by Syah Afandin with a value of at least IDR 3.5 billion. The allegations are related to mutations and filling positions in the Langkat Regency Government, the appointment of school principals, to the procurement of school uniforms which are still being investigated by investigators.

As a result of his actions, Syah Afandin as the recipient of the bribe was suspected of violating Article 12 letter a or letter b and/or Article 12B of Law Number 31 of 1999 concerning the Eradication of Corruption as amended by Law Number 20 of 2001.

Meanwhile, Yaqub, as the party suspected of giving bribes, was charged with Article 605 or Article 606 paragraph (1) of Law Number 1 of 2023 concerning the Criminal Code in conjunction with Law Number 1 of 2026 concerning Criminal Adjustment in conjunction with Article 20 letter c of Law Number 1 of 2023 concerning the Criminal Code.
